Output 152af80741a090b32fedd5fbded0e23599111bf39c4eff044ca53a67fdce43ed:0

value
3908710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376d81789b3fbd080b8b5fe581ae2d182aa9d OP_EQUAL
address
3BMEXsrJknWncLdigLyoepJT357RW9gbSg
transaction
152af80741a090b32fedd5fbded0e23599111bf39c4eff044ca53a67fdce43ed
confirmations
357346
spent
true